About [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ate
[(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ate (PubChem CID 2380223) has the molecular formula C19H19NO4
and a molecular weight of 325.36 g/mol. Its IUPAC name is [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ate.

What is the SMILES notation for [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ate?
The canonical SMILES for [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ate is C[C@@H]1CCc2nc3ccccc3c(C(=O)O[C@H]3CCOC3=O)c2C1.
What is the InChIKey of [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ate?
The InChIKey is QYFQXTIHTQDAFD-BZNIZROVSA-N. The full InChI is InChI=1S/C19H19NO4/c1-11-6-7-15-13(10-11)17(12-4-2-3-5-14(12)20-15)19(22)24-16-8-9-23-18(16)21/h2-5,11,16H,6-10H2,1H3/t11-,16+/m1/s1.
What are the key properties of [(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ate?
[(3S)-2-oxooxolan-3-yl] (2R)-2-methyl-1,2,3,4-tetrahydroacridine-9-carboxylate has a molecular weight of 325.36 g/mol, XLogP of 2.83, 2 rotatable bonds, 0 hydrogen bond donors, and 5 hydrogen bond acceptors.
